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al

Catching the signs of a pool leak early can save you thousands of dollars in damage and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your pool area, it’s likely a sign of a leak. Don’t ignore it – address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age

If you see water damage on your pool deck, walls, or surrounding areas, it’s time to call our team. We’ll assess the damage and develop a plan to extract the water and repair any affected areas.

Increased Water Bill

If your water bill is higher than usual, it could be a sign of a leak. Don’t wait – call our team to investigate and repair the issue.

Q: What causes pool leaks?

A: Pool le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including worn-out seals, cracks in the pool shell, and improper installation. Our team will assess the damage and develop a plan to repair the issue.
